Abstract
A silo-mountable rescue assembly for accessing a distressed person in a silo includes a tripod that is configured to couple to a top of a silo so that an apex of the tripod is substantially centrally positioned over an opening in the silo. A block and tackle is coupled to the tripod proximate to the apex. The block and tackle is configured to lower equipment and personnel into the silo to rescue a distressed person in the silo.
